Management with right atrium to jugular and brachiocephalic vein bypass for dialysis catheter-related superior vena cava syndrome

open access: yesJournal of Vascular Surgery Cases and Innovative Techniques, 2023
Superior vena cava (SVC) syndrome is a spectrum of potentially life-threatening clinical manifestations resulting from either partial or complete obstruction of central venous blood flow. Approximately 70% of cases are caused by malignancy.

Adhesion‐Related Macrophages Regulate Metabolic Homeostasis Through CAV‐1 Dependency

open access: yesAdvanced Science, EarlyView.
Adipose tissue harbors a distinct macrophage subpopulation, termed adhesion‐related macrophages (ARMs), which stably adhere to adipocytes. In obesity, ARMs represent the major expanding macrophage subset. They acquire material from adipocytes and rely on Caveolin‐1 for sustained lipid handling.

Superior Venacava Thrombus-A Case Report

open access: yesJournal of College of Medical Sciences-Nepal, 2016
Superior venacava (SVC) thrombus is a condition requiring immediate diagnosis and treatment. SVC thrombus causes obstruction of blood flow through the SVC resulting in severe decrease in venous return from the head, neck and upper extremity to the heart.
